What Is Co-Washing?

Co-washing means using a conditioner-based cleanser instead of a traditional shampoo. It gently lifts dirt, sweat, and light product buildup while depositing moisture at the same time. The result is clean hair that still feels soft and hydrated—not stripped and squeaky.


Aveda’s co-wash formula is designed specifically for curls, coils, and waves. It has just enough cleansing power to remove what you don’t want without touching the natural oils your curls depend on for definition and shine.


How to Use the Co-Wash

Apply a generous amount to wet hair and work it through with your fingers, focusing on the scalp. Massage gently to lift dirt and oil, then distribute through the lengths of your hair. Rinse thoroughly. No separate conditioner is needed on co-wash days, though you can follow with a leave-in or styling product.


Use the co-wash on days between your regular shampoo washes. For example, if you shampoo with Be Curly Advanced Shampoo once a week, use the co-wash on one or two mid-week wash days to refresh without stripping.


Who Should Co-Wash

Co-washing is especially beneficial for Type 3 and Type 4 curl patterns, which tend to be drier and more fragile. If your curls feel crunchy, look dull, or lose definition after shampooing, you’re likely overwashing—and the co-wash is your solution.

Frequently Asked Questions


Does co-washing actually get hair clean?

Yes, for light to moderate buildup. Co-wash formulas contain gentle surfactants that remove sweat, dirt, and light product residue. However, you should still use a regular shampoo once a week or every two weeks to do a deeper cleanse, especially if you use heavy styling products.


Can co-washing cause buildup?

If you only co-wash and never shampoo, you may eventually get buildup. The key is alternating between co-wash days and shampoo days. Most curly-haired clients do well with one shampoo day and one to two co-wash days per week.


Can I use this co-wash on wavy hair?

Yes. While it’s formulated for curls and coils, it works beautifully on wavy hair too. If you have fine wavy hair, use a lighter amount to avoid weighing down your waves.
